Bob,

The Lollar horseshoe is a very faithful handmade pickup that will drop right into a RIC. Jason Lollar makes them personally, and you usually have to put a deposit down to get on the waiting list for when he makes them.

If you need a horeshoe for a restoration and replacement, it's practically impossible to get one from the factory, and the few you see for sale privately can be very expensive.

Basically, he's a craftsman producing very limited amounts of hand built quality pickups for the enthusiasts that can't get them anywhere else. You'll never see him mass producing them, and the high cost of them would make it prohibitive for anyone to build fakes around them.

"The Lollar horseshoe is a very faithful handmade pickup"

Well, almost faithful as the shoes themselves are a three piece laminate, unlike the original one piece shoes. But they do look good and from what I have heard from other forumites, they sound just as good.
